Current Situation

To date, the BJP has won zero seats in Kerala during the Lok Sabha election, indicating that the party has not yet opened its account in this contentious election. While there are indications that the party may win in a handful of seats, such as Thiruvananthapuram Attingal, Palakkad, Pathanamthitta, and Thrissur, the prospects remain uncertain.

Key Challenges

One of the primary obstacles the BJP faces in Kerala is the lack of community polarization. Unlike in other states, communities in Kerala have not yet become deeply divided along political lines, making it difficult for Modi to rally support through small promises like infrastructure development.

Another critical challenge is cross-voting, especially in areas where the BJP may seem likely to win. In such instances, the Communists and Congress are often seen aligning against the BJP to counter any potential victory. This polarization is particularly concerning, especially given Kerala's high literacy rate and progressive governance.

Recent Developments

As of mid-January 2024, Kerala stands a good chance of securing 2–3 seats, particularly in Thrissur, Thiruvananthapuram, and Pathanamthitta. Palakkad and Kasaragod are also showing promising signs of BJP support, although these areas historically lean left-wing. The recent visits by Prime Minister Modi have also influenced the grassroots dynamics, especially in Thrissur, where the BJP is targeting women and other newly added voter segments.
